Global shares have fallen sharply as concerns about weak global economic growth knock investor confidence.

In the US, the Dow Jones fell by more than 400 points, or 2.5%, to 15,911, before recovering slightly. European markets were also sharply lower.

The Dow is down more than 1,000 points, or 6%, in the past month.

Oil prices also continued to slide, with Brent crude falling below $85 a barrel and US light crude dipping below $81.

Brent crude has fallen by 20% since the summer on concerns of oversupply, as output increases and forecasts for future demand fall because of concerns about sluggish global growth.

On stock markets, the main Cac 40 index in France closed down 3.6%, while Germany's Dax index and the UK's FTSE 100 both ended the day down about 2.8%.
